Verdict

Rock Hill, SC offers better overall compensation for dialysis technicians, winning 3 out of 4 metrics compared to Greenville.

The salary gap between Greenville and Rock Hill is $49 (0.12%). Rock Hill's median is -13.14% compared to the US national median of $45,322.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Greenville spans $25,532,Rock Hill spans $32,345. Rock Hill has a wider pay range, suggesting more variation in pay between entry-level and experienced dialysis technicians.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Rock Hill ($43,025 effective) pays 2.05% more than Greenville ($42,161 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, dialysis technician salaries in Greenville grew 5.1% from 2021 to 2025, compared to 5.5% growth in Rock Hill over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 2.41%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
